babelflow: Add spec (#20544)

This commit is contained in:
Tomoyasu Nojiri 2020-12-25 07:54:24 +09:00 committed by GitHub
parent cfbe3aa056
commit b1a6e583c0
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-25,6 +25,7 @@ class Babelflow(CMakePackage):
variant("shared", default=True, description="Build Babelflow as shared libs") variant("shared", default=True, description="Build Babelflow as shared libs")
def cmake_args(self): def cmake_args(self):
spec = self.spec
args = [ args = [
'-DBUILD_SHARED_LIBS:BOOL={0}'.format( '-DBUILD_SHARED_LIBS:BOOL={0}'.format(
'ON' if '+shared' in spec else 'OFF')] 'ON' if '+shared' in spec else 'OFF')]